CG: Expenditure: % of GDP

2001 - 2020 | Yearly | % | World Bank

CG: Expenditure: % of GDP data was reported at 17.795 % in 2020. This records an increase from the previous number of 16.227 % for 2019. CG: Expenditure: % of GDP data is updated yearly, averaging 16.325 % from Dec 2001 to 2020, with 20 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 28.672 % in 2004 and a record low of 10.177 % in 2011. CG: Expenditure: % of GDP data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s Congo, Republic of – Table CG.World Bank.WDI: Government Revenue, Expenditure and Finance. Expense is cash payments for operating activities of the government in providing goods and services. It includes compensation of employees (such as wages and salaries), interest and subsidies, grants, social benefits, and other expenses such as rent and dividends.;International Monetary Fund, Government Finance Statistics Yearbook and data files, and World Bank and OECD GDP estimates.;Weighted average;

CG: Net Lending (+) / Net Borrowing (-): % of GDP

2001 - 2016 | Yearly | % | World Bank

CG: Net Lending (+) / Net Borrowing (-): % of GDP data was reported at -5.854 % in 2016. This records an increase from the previous number of -9.094 % for 2015. CG: Net Lending (+) / Net Borrowing (-): % of GDP data is updated yearly, averaging 6.222 % from Dec 2001 to 2016, with 16 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 36.411 % in 2010 and a record low of -9.094 % in 2015. CG: Net Lending (+) / Net Borrowing (-): % of GDP data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s Congo, Republic of – Table CG.World Bank.WDI: Government Revenue, Expenditure and Finance. Net lending (+) / net borrowing (–) equals government revenue minus expense, minus net investment in nonfinancial assets. It is also equal to the net result of transactions in financial assets and liabilities. Net lending/net borrowing is a summary measure indicating the extent to which government is either putting financial resources at the disposal of other sectors in the economy or abroad, or utilizing the financial resources generated by other sectors in the economy or from abroad.;International Monetary Fund, Government Finance Statistics Yearbook and data files.;Weighted average;
